<style id="i20mm"></style><area id="7x21v"></area><em dropzone="bs8jw"></em><area id="7i772"></area><acronym draggable="1wd43"></acronym><kbd lang="y9hy4"></kbd><legend lang="ljvo4"></legend><map id="gcmzz"></map><map draggable="i06_d"></map><ol dir="8d7r6"></ol>

            移动支付的新时代

            如今啊,大家都知道,移动支付已经渗透到我们生活的方方面面。想想,去超市买东西,扫个二维码或者用手机就能支付,方便得不行。不过,随着加密货币的流行,很多人开始着手考虑,哎,要不要搞一个手机区块链钱包呢?这可不是小事,说到底,它就是一个安全、便捷存放和管理数字资产的工具。今天,我想跟大家聊聊手机区块链钱包的开发,分享一些我的个人见解和经验。

            区块链钱包到底是什么?

            可能很多人听说过区块链钱包,但不知道它到底干嘛用的。其实,简单来说,区块链钱包就是一个可以储存你的加密货币(比特币、以太坊等)的地方。它的主要功能是发送、接收和管理你的数字资产。而且,这个钱包分为“热钱包”和“冷钱包”,具体又是啥?热钱包就是在线的,比如手机应用;冷钱包就是离线的,比如硬件钱包。

            为什么选择手机钱包?

            很多人可能会想:“为什么我不选个硬件钱包呢?”确实,硬件钱包安全性更高,但不方便携带。不过,手机钱包呢?随时随地可以查看余额、进行交易,简直不要太方便!想象一下,搭公交的时候,刷微信支付,还能顺便检查一下自己的比特币涨了没,感觉十分炫酷。

            区块链钱包开发的基本流程

            如果你准备开发一个手机区块链钱包,首先得搞清楚开发流程。下面我就大概讲讲,实际上每一步都需要一些细致入微的操作。

            需求分析

            首先要明确的是,消费者需要什么样的功能。是简单的转账、收款,还是要支持多种币种、交易所信息、甚至去中心化交易?这一步很重要,毕竟搞清楚需求才能对症下药。

            技术选型

            接下来,你得选择合适的技术栈。比如,想用 React Native 做跨平台开发,还是专门做 iOS 和 Android 的原生开发?这就涉及到成本、时间以及用户体验等多个因素。再比如,怎么保证钱包的安全性就是个大问题。用助记词、私钥加密等手段,确保用户的资产不被盗用。

            功能开发

            然后,就是各个功能模块的开发了。一般来说,一个完整的区块链钱包需要有发送、接收、查看交易记录、币种选择等基础功能。此外,还可以考虑加入一些增值服务,比如市场行情、新闻推送等。让用户在使用钱包的同时,能够获取更多信息,提高用户粘性。

            测试和上线

            功能开发完了,接下来就是测试阶段。测试可灵活多样,包括单元测试、功能测试、用户体验测试。任何一个小bug都可能导致用户的资产损失,所以这一步一定要严谨。测试完成后,就可以上线了,让用户开始使用你开发的钱包。

            安全性问题如何解决?

            大家可能最担心的就是安全性的问题。这是无可厚非的,毕竟涉及到财产嘛。为了提高安全性,开发者需要考虑以下几种方式:

            私钥加密

            在用户的钱包中,有个非常重要的东西——私钥。如果用户的私钥丢了,钱包里的资产基本是没了。那么,如何保护私钥呢?用加密算法加密存储,是个不错的选择。可以使用对称加密算法,比如 AES,加密后即使黑客入侵也无法轻松获取。

            多重验证

            有些钱包还会考虑加入多重验证的功能。比如,当用户进行大额转账时,可以要求输入多次密码、指纹识别,或者二次验证通过手机短信等方式。这样就能在一定程度上保护用户的资产安全。

            用户教育

            除了技术手段,用户本身的安全意识也很重要。很多时候,用户因为自己不小心泄露了账户信息导致损失,所以开发者可以在钱包中设置一些安全教育引导,让用户了解如何保护自己的资产。

            市场前景如何?

            那么,手机区块链钱包的市场前景到底如何呢?从我观察的角度来看,随着加密货币投资的普及,越来越多的人开始接触数字资产管理,需求自然也水涨船高。从长远来看,手机区块链钱包行业仍然是非常具有潜力的市场。

            同时,相关技术的不断创新,也为钱包的功能拓展提供了新的可能。比如,未来可能会有更多的智能合约应用,让用户不仅能管理资产,还能参与到更多区块链应用中去。

            开发中的一些挑战

            当然,开发过程中肯定会遇到一些挑战和困难。比如,如何在快速发展的行业中保持技术的先进性和用户体验的优质,这个是每个开发者都需要思考的问题。此外,法规的不确定性也是一个需要注意的点,各国对于加密货币的监管政策时有变化,开发者需要及时调整策略。

            结合个人故事

            我身边就有朋友因为数字资产管理而买了手机区块链钱包。在初期,他对这个事情一无所知,结果各种尝试下来,丢失了一些资产。后来,他就跟我分享他的经验,说还是得多了解一下,尤其是安全性的问题。这让我意识到,不只是开发者,普通用户同样需要教育和引导,不然真是可能因为一些小失误就造成不可逆的损失。

            总结一下

            虽然现在市场上已有很多成功的手机区块链钱包,但相信随着技术的日益进步,未来会有更多机会。而作为开发者,如果能够抓住这些机会,完善钱包的功能和安全性,相信会有更美好的前景。

            最后,咱们说,不管是开发还是使用手机区块链钱包,安全始终是第一位的。希望每个人都能在这个行业里找到合适的方法,安全、便捷地管理自己的数字资产。